The National Football League and the players association have officially unveiled a revamped on-field discipline framework following months of collaborative planning. Each season, the league approves new regulations that team owners and player representatives meticulously negotiate during the offseason.
The primary focus of these ongoing discussions remains centered on enhancing the safety of the athletes who serve as the heartbeat of the sport. From outlawing helmet-to-helmet collisions and horse-collar tackles in past years to introducing strict restrictions on hip-drop tackles, the game constantly evolves.
Last season also featured a complete overhaul of the kickoff rules as the league sought to protect players while fostering an explosive brand of football. In a joint announcement ahead of the upcoming campaign, both organizations highlighted the importance of these updated rules.
Fans and analysts continue to monitor how these disciplinary adjustments will impact game strategies and player conduct on the field. The ongoing regulatory updates reflect a sustained commitment to modernizing professional football for everyone involved.
